Курсовая работа на тему: Управление и автоматизация баз данных: Разработка базы данных Firebird 4.0

×

Курсовая на тему:

Управление и автоматизация баз данных: Разработка базы данных Firebird 4.0

🔥 Новые задания

Заработайте бонусы!

Быстрое выполнение за 30 секунд
💳 Можно оплатить бонусами всю работу
Моментальное начисление
Получить бонусы
Актуальность

Актуальность

Разработка и управление базами данных является ключевым аспектом в информационных системах современности.

Цель

Цель

Создание эффективной базы данных на платформе Firebird 4.0 с практической автоматизацией процессов.

Задачи

Задачи

  • Изучить теоретические аспекты управления базами данных
  • Разработать схему базы данных для Firebird 4.0
  • Автоматизировать взаимодействие с базой данных
  • Создать и протестировать практическую реализацию базы данных
  • Оценить производительность и эффективность базы данных

Введение

Современные информационные технологии стремительно развиваются, и управление данными становится одной из ключевых задач организаций и предприятий. Системы управления базами данных (СУБД) играют важнейшую роль в обеспечении эффективного хранения, обработки и анализа информации. Настоящая тема "Управление и автоматизация баз данных: Разработка базы данных Firebird 4.0" актуальна, поскольку выбор правильной СУБД и методов её проектирования напрямую влияет на производительность и масштабируемость информационных систем. В условиях возрастающей конкуренции успешное применение технологий, связанных с управлением базами данных, может привести к значительному увеличению эффективности бизнеса и снижению затрат на обработку информации.

Целью данной работы является исследование особенностей и возможностей системы управления базами данных Firebird 4.0, а также разработка эффективной базы данных с её использованием. Для достижения этой цели необходимо решить ряд задач: провести обзор существующих СУБД, изучить архитектуру Firebird 4.0, рассмотреть методы проектирования баз данных, автоматизации их управления, а также реализовать тестовую базу данных и проанализировать её производительность.

В качестве объекта исследования выбрана система управления базами данных Firebird 4.0, а предметом исследования является разработка и автоматизация процессов управления базой данных на основе этой СУБД. В ходе работы будет представлено обобщённое содержание, затрагивающее ключевые аспекты работы с данными в данном программном обеспечении.

Первая глава курсовой работы начинается с обзора систем управления базами данных, где будет рассмотрено множество решений, их типы и области применения. На этом фоне уделено внимание архитектуре Firebird 4.0: основные компоненты и принцип работы системы будут в деталях разобраны, акцентируя внимание на её уникальных особенностях. Также будут освещены преимущества и недостатки Firebird 4.0, что даст возможность оценить её конкурентоспособность на рынке.

Во второй главе описываются методы проектирования баз данных. Будут рассмотрены концептуальное, логическое и физическое проектирование, а также процесс создания модели ER. Последующее внимание уделяется созданию схемы базы данных для Firebird 4.0 с акцентом на оптимизацию структуры, нормализацию данных и создание таблиц. Важным аспектом этой главы станет обсуждение методов обеспечения целостности данных, включая ограничения и триггеры.

Третья глава посвящена автоматизации взаимодействия с базой данных. Основные способы автоматизации задач с помощью SQL-запросов, в том числе использование хранимых процедур и триггеров, будут детально освещены. Далее, с помощью обзора инструментов для администрирования Firebird, включая графические интерфейсы и командные утилиты, будут представлены возможности эффективного управления базой данных. Рассмотрение встроенных процедур Firebird 4.0 поможет продемонстрировать способы автоматизации рутинных задач.

В последней, четвёртой главе, будет описан практический аспект курсовой работы. Процесс создания тестовой базы данных на Firebird 4.0 будет проделан с самого начала: от установки до заполнения данными. Тестовые запросы и методы проверки корректности выполнения операций помогут оценить функциональность базы. В завершение, анализ производительности базы данных и использование различных метрик дадут представление о быстродействии системы и её способности справляться с нагрузками.

Глава 1. Основные понятия и архитектура систем управления базами данных

1.1. Системы управления базами данных: обзор

В данном разделе будет представлен обзор различных систем управления базами данных, их типов и применения. Рассматриваются основные решения на рынке, а также их особенности и преимущества.

1.2. Архитектура СУБД Firebird 4.0

В данном разделе будет обсуждаться архитектура Firebird 4.0, основные компоненты и принцип работы. Особое внимание будет уделено его структуре и механизму обработки запросов.

1.3. Преимущества и недостатки Firebird 4.0

В данном разделе будут рассмотрены преимущества и недостатки использования Firebird 4.0 по сравнению с другими системами. Анализ будет включать аспекты производительности, поддержки и возможностей масштабирования.

Глава 2. Проектирование базы данных

2.1. Методы проектирования баз данных

В данном разделе будет рассмотрено несколько методов проектирования баз данных, включая концептуальное, логическое и физическое проектирование. Описывается процесс модели ER и его применение.

2.2. Создание схемы базы данных для Firebird 4.0

В данном разделе будет продемонстрирована разработка схемы базы данных, оптимизированной для Firebird 4.0. Рассматриваются подходы к нормализации данных и создание таблиц.

2.3. Обеспечение целостности данных

В данном разделе будут обсуждаться методы обеспечения целостности данных в базе. Рассматриваются ограничения, триггеры и механизмы контроля целостности, доступные в Firebird 4.0.

Глава 3. Автоматизация взаимодействия с базой данных

3.1. Автоматизация задач с использованием SQL

В данном разделе будут охвачены основные способы автоматизации задач с помощью SQL-запросов. Рассматривается использование хранимых процедур и триггеров для автоматизации.

3.2. Инструменты для администрирования Firebird

В данном разделе будет представлен обзор инструментов для администрирования баз данных Firebird, включая графические интерфейсы и командные утилиты. Описываются их возможности и особенности использования.

3.3. Применение встроенных процедур для автоматизации

В данном разделе будут рассмотрены встроенные процедуры Firebird 4.0, их создание и использование для автоматизации повторяющихся задач в базе данных. Примеры написания и применения таких процедур.

Глава 4. Практическая реализация базы данных

4.1. Создание тестовой базы данных

В данном разделе будет описан процесс создания тестовой базы данных на Firebird 4.0. Рассматриваются все шаги, начиная от установки до инициализации данных.

4.2. Заполнение и тестирование базы данных

В данном разделе будет проведено заполнение тестовой базы данных образцовыми данными. Описываются тестовые запросы и методы проверки корректности выполнения операций.

4.3. Оценка производительности базы данных

В данном разделе будет проведен анализ производительности разработанной базы данных. Рассматриваются метрики и инструменты, используемые для оценки быстродействия и эффективности работы с данными.

Заключение

Заключение доступно в полной версии работы.

Список литературы

Заключение доступно в полной версии работы.

Полная версия работы

  • Иконка страниц 30+ страниц научного текста
  • Иконка библиографии Список литературы
  • Иконка таблицы Таблицы в тексте
  • Иконка документа Экспорт в Word
  • Иконка авторского права Авторское право на работу
  • Иконка речи Речь для защиты в подарок
Создать подобную работу